Product description
Table constructed from boxed volumes in mm 10 thick transparent extralight tempered glass, obtained thanks to complex gluing manufacturing. The top is supported by two “T” shaped bases and it has a parallelepiped shape opened on the two The result is a table of great strength and formal purity and at the same time characterized by the great volumetric presence.
